NTSB Identification: MKC84LA282.
The docket is stored on NTSB microfiche number 26536.
Accident occurred Friday, September 21, 1984 in BRECKENRIDGE, MO
Aircraft: CESSNA T210M, registration: N761YR
Injuries: 3 Minor.
NTSB investigators may not have traveled in support of this investigation and used data provided by various sources to prepare this aircraft accident report.ON A VFR X-COUNTRY FLT THE ACFT EXPERIENCED AN ENG FAILURE AND THE PLT EXECUTED A NIGHT EMERGENCY LANDING INTO A SOY BEAN FIELD. INVESTIGATION REVEALED THAT A COUNTERWEIGHT PIN CAME OUT OF THE CRANKSHAFT COUNTERWEIGHT DUE TO A FAILURE OF A LOCK RING RESULTING IN AN OVERLOAD SHEAR OF A LOOSE COUNTERWEIGHT INSIDE THE ENG.
